By Ill-Green Sat Jun 11, 2011 8:00 am
Yeah, its real. Copyrighting a song with your pseudonym is a great way to prove your name in court but can be limited, because your work is protected but if someone copyrighted their work long before you and registered with the same name, then in court you would lose because the date of register will show that he was first.

Here's the thought that made me register my name:

All the work I did has some good recognition in the underground, now imagine some label picks up on it and decides to use my name to create their own artist and they make millions off some wack rap. With this lifetime document I can legally prove that I'm the real McCoy and the copyrights will just be the frosting to the cake.
